Cognitive biases play a significant role in how players choose casino games. These psychological shortcuts can lead to irrational decision-making, influencing gamblers to favor certain games over others. For example, the availability heuristic often causes players to choose games they have recently seen advertised or have played in the past, regardless of their actual odds or payouts. Another common bias is the illusion of control, where players believe they can influence the outcome of games that are primarily based on chance. This is particularly evident in games like roulette or dice games, where the act of placing a bet may give the player a false sense of control, leading them to make choices that don’t necessarily correlate with better odds. Understanding these biases can help both players and casino operators create better gaming experiences.
Emotions greatly affect decision-making in gambling contexts. Many players select their games based on how they are feeling at any given moment. For instance, someone feeling particularly lucky may gravitate towards high-stakes games, while a player in a more cautious mood might prefer lower-risk options. The emotional state of a player can also drive the choice between skill-based games like poker and chance-based games like slots, as some players may seek to exert their skills to cope with their emotional state.
Furthermore, the thrill and excitement generated by casino environments can enhance the emotional appeal of certain games. The sounds of spinning wheels, ringing coins, and cheers from nearby tables create an exhilarating atmosphere that can lead players to choose games that heighten their emotions. Such a connection between emotion and game selection underscores the need for casinos to consider the emotional experiences they create when designing game offerings.
Social dynamics are another vital component influencing casino game choices. People are inherently social beings, and many choose games based on social interactions and the community surrounding them. Games like poker, which require player interaction, often attract those looking for a social experience rather than just the thrill of winning. The social aspect can also be a significant factor in selecting a game like craps, where group dynamics and shared excitement enhance the overall experience.
Additionally, peer pressure and recommendations from friends can strongly impact game selection. Many players are likely to try games that their friends enjoy or those that they perceive as more popular. Understanding these social influences can help casinos market their games more effectively and create communal experiences that draw players in.
The design and features of casino games can also sway player choices significantly. Eye-catching graphics, engaging storylines, and immersive sound effects attract players and encourage them to select specific games. For example, modern slot machines often incorporate themes from popular culture, which can lead to increased interest and engagement. Players are likely to choose games that resonate with their interests or that provide visually stimulating experiences.
Moreover, the introduction of features like progressive jackpots, bonus rounds, and free spins creates an allure that can be irresistible to many players. These elements enhance the excitement and potential rewards of each game, influencing players to make choices based on perceived value and entertainment. By continually innovating game design and features, casinos can effectively attract and retain players.
